Arkansas Cybersecurity: A Digital Wild West Showdown with Rising Threats

Arkansas, the digital neighborhood getting egged by cyber bullies, saw its cybersecurity incidents double in fiscal 2023. Despite being the cyber equivalent of a leaky dam plugged with bubblegum, they’re fighting back with legislation, a cyber response board, and minimum cybersecurity standards.
